ASSOCIATION OF CONSUMER VEHICLE LESSORS, founded in 1996, is a small nonprofit that reported $254K in total revenue in fiscal year 2023. Revenue fell 27% from the prior year — a significant decline worth monitoring.

Mission

TO PROVIDE INFORMATION TO CONSUMERS TO ASSIST THEM IN MAKING INFORMED DECISIONS ON VEHICLE LEASING AND FINANCINGAND TO PROVIDE OBJECTIVE INFORMATION TO DEALERS TO INFORM CONSUMERS ABOUT LEASING BENEFITS.
